West Harlem Tennis Clinic: A Community Win

HJTEP brought the joy of tennis to West Harlem at the Denny Farrell Riverbank State Park on May 3. The sun was shining, and spirits were high as dozens of young athletes came out to learn the basics, run through drills, and experience the excitement of the sport, many for the first time.
HJTEP's coaches, joined by several student-athletes, led the charge with patience, encouragement, and skill. A special shoutout goes to the students who stepped up to help the younger kids get comfortable on court.
Following the clinic, HJTEP staff treated the student-athletes to lunch to celebrate their hard work as role models throughout the day.
